Implements and maintains the business contingency program. Partners with management to promote the strategic direction and plans to ensure business continuity and effective emergency management. We are looking for a Business Resilience Specialist within the European Resilience & Governance function. We are seeking a strong resilience/ continuity specialist to partner with leaders across the European business to promote the strategic direction and plans to ensure business continuity and effective emergency management. **Core Responsibilities** - The role requires business continuity experience, and the key responsibility will be to create and implement an enhanced business continuity framework for the European business. - Assists with the development, maintenance, exercising and testing of crisis management and business continuity plans. - Maintain governance and oversight of the IT Disaster Recovery Plan and scenario playbooks. - Provides direction on the operating strategies for the continuation of business within a recovery time objective. - Identifies and quantifies the potential impact of various disruptions and disaster scenarios and make recommendations and elevates to management. - Monitors and reports on the compliance of business continuity processes, readiness, events and exercise results to senior management and key stakeholders. - Provides training, maintenance, and support for approved contingency planning tools and plans. Shares information on enterprise continuity processes, standards, and initiatives. - Builds and maintains effective relationships to support the business continuity framework. Assists business partners and business units in defining, implementing, and improving local efforts to ensure the European business is resilient. - Maintains awareness of regulatory risk and control topics. Seeks to understand broad industry and Vanguard trends regarding risk and control. - Participates in special projects and performs other duties as assigned. - Carry out crisis management tabletop exercises for senior management. - Monitor and report on the status of business continuity readiness - Maintain governance and oversight of the IT Disaster Recovery Plan and exercise. - Review, audit, and update BC plans, with the business, regularly to reflect changing organisational needs or external threats. **What it takes** - Minimum of five years related work experience. Business continuity and/or disaster recovery experience is essential and operational resilience experience is preferred. - Undergraduate degree or equivalent combination of training and experience. - Experience of working in the financial sector is desirable. -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ills will be key as this role will face off to a variety of stakeholders across the business. - Relevant Business Continuity qualifications are preferred; Certified Business Continuity Professional (CBCP) (CBCP) or Master Business Continuity Professional (MBCP). - Able to work independently and across different teams. **Special Factors** - Vanguard is not offering visa sponsorship for this position. - This is a hybrid position and would require you to work in the office location Tuesday-Thursday. **About Vanguard** Vanguard is an investment company unlike any other. It was founded by Jack Bogle in the US in 1975 on a simple but ground-breaking idea: that an investment company should handle its funds solely in the interests of its clients. Jack helped bring investing to the masses with the index fund. Index funds do not pick individual shares or bonds to beat the market. They supervise the performance of the entire market. Or as Jack put it, "Don't look for the needle in the haystack. Just buy the haystack”. We have stood for low-cost, uncomplicated investing ever since.
